Sex-Dimorphic Analyses Identify Novel and Sex-Specific Genetic Associations in Inflammatory Bowel Disease.
Inflammatory bowel diseases - 3 Oct 2023
Khrom Michelle, Li Dalin, Naito Takeo, Lee Ho-Su, Botwin Gregory J, Potdar Alka A, Boucher Gabrielle, Yang Shaohong, Mengesha Emebet, Dube Shishir, Song Kyuyoung, McGovern Dermot P B, Haritunians Talin
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Sex is an integral variable often overlooked in complex disease genetics. Differences between sexes have been reported in natural history, disease complications, and age of onset in inflammatory bowel disease (IBD). While association studies have identified >230 IBD loci, there have been a limited number of studies investigating sex differences underlying these genetic associations. METHODS: We report...
